Hanging gardens or Ferozeshah Mehta gardens is situated just opposite to the Kamala Nehru Park.

Gardens were built in the early 1880. It was built over Mumbai's main water basin to cover it from the contamaining activity of the nearby Towers of Silence. The garden offers stunning view of the sunset over the Arabian Sea.

It is perched at the top of Malabar Hill and brings you close to nature. These terraced gardens are also known as Ferozeshah Mehta Gardens.

The gardens are popular with local residents for their early morning or late evening walk.

It is built over three pools which store 30 millions gallons of water. In the mornings, it is the haunt of joggers and fitness freaks and a hideout place for young couples in the evenings.
